Maya wants to make a pyramid out of plaster for her social studies class. How much plasterdoes she need to make a rectangular py

ramid with the dimensions shown below?A11 in. +6 in.8 in.+Type the answer in the box.cubic inches

The volume of the pyramid can be determined as,

V=\frac{1}{3}\times area\text{ of base}\times height

Substituting the given values,

\begin{gathered} V=\frac{1}{3}\times(8in\times6in)\times11in \\ =176in^3 \end{gathered}

Thus, the 176 cubic inches of plaster is required.
